Strangest thing happens with the latest v1.18 on same project I was working on with 1.16. While playing, one of the tracks using any UAD-1 plug-in starts eating up at least 50% of the cpu (according to the perf meter). It's random, it can be any of the track using UAD-1 plugs. Sometimes the master, sometimes a track, sometimes a folder containing at least a track using a UAD-1 plug. While it's playing, if I disable the UAD-1 plug in in the FX chain, it goes back to normal.
More on that :
I have these 3 tracks in a folder, each using ReaGate + 1176LN uad + Sony DX track EQ . The folder has a Sony DX Track EQ. The folder started to use 30% of cpu. I stopped playing. I soloed the folder and started playback again. => 30-40%. While playing, I solo the 1st track in the folder => eats 30-40% of cpu. I open the 2nd one, it eats up 30% as well. Open the 3rd, guess what, eats up 30% too. So I have 3 tracks opened using 90-100% of my amd64 3800+.
And it ended up in a blue screen with DRIVER_CORRUPTED_MMPOOL error message... :P
Any clue of what's happenening ?
AMD64 3800+
RAM 2Gigs
XP SP2
RME Fireface 800
UAD-1 V4.4
